## Webhook retries — quick refresher for sync

Quick note before Thursday's sync: Plumbline retries failed webhook deliveries with exponential backoff — 30s, 2m, 10m, then hourly up to 24 hours. After that, the event lands in the dead-letter queue and somebody (usually Marisol's team) has to replay it by hand. We don't dedupe on the receiver side, so endpoints must be idempotent. Full semantics and the replay procedure live on the internal page below.

wiki page, tahaf-tajog: https://jira.ordindyn.corp/pipeline

Ticket: Unlock migration vault for Ironvine ORM refactor

New team members: the legacy Ironvine ORM layer is being replaced module by module, and the schema snapshots needed for safe refactoring sit in a locked vault nobody has opened since the last owner left. We recovered the credentials from escrow this week. The passphrase follows below.

unlock words, kajog-yawip: istwyn-casath-aldok

BREAK-GLASS ACCESS — Shorely tide-table widget

The tide-table widget on the Shorely harbor dashboard pulls predictions from a sealed datastore that refreshes nightly. If the refresh job dies and the widget shows stale tides for more than two cycles, on-call may invoke break-glass access to force a manual reload. Log the incident first, then open the override console on the primary node. When prompted, supply the recovery passphrase below.

strongbox words: norwyn-wenael-aldvan-aldiel-wendor-holael

# Service Accounts: Queue Compaction

The Hollowpipe message queue runs log compaction nightly under the svc-compactor account. Compaction keeps only the latest record per key; don't rely on replaying full history. If a topic skips compaction twice, page the data platform rotation. New team members can inspect compactor status via the Hollowpipe admin API using the key below.

service key, baguf-kajof: kto23_0N0alcToS5tihzYHFIEQ5XV